Sat 752022271361398

decimal
150404.2271361398
degree
0°150404′1220″2271361398‴
percentile
35.81058438993443%
name
infyvuwgppr
cycle
0
epoch
0
period
74
block
150404
offset
2271361398
timestamp
rarity
common